Database Administrator

6 days ago


Pune, Maharashtra, India DEW SOLUTIONS Full time ₹ 6,00,000 - ₹ 18,00,000 per year

Job Summary:

We are seeking an experienced Database Administrator (DBA) to manage, optimize, and secure databases for large-scale digital

platforms. The role involves overseeing database design, query optimization, data migration, and integration with cloud-based

services. The ideal candidate will have hands-on experience with MySQL and AWS DynamoDB, strong skills in SQL development, and the ability to ensure data integrity, performance, and availability across production and reporting environments.

Key Responsibilities:

  • Design, implement, and maintain relational and NoSQL databases (MySQL and DynamoDB) for scalable and high-availability

    applications.
  • Develop, optimize, and tune complex SQL queries, stored procedures, and data retrieval logic for performance and efficiency.
  • Manage database migrations, schema updates, and version control between development, staging, and production

    environments.
  • Monitor database health, performance metrics, and query execution plans using AWS and open-source monitoring tools.
  • Ensure data consistency, security, and backup/recovery mechanisms in line with government data policies and CERT-In

    advisories.
  • Collaborate with backend and DevOps teams to design data access patterns, indexes, and caching strategies for real-time

    operations.
  • Support ETL processes and assist in data preparation for reporting and analytics layers.
  • Assist in the creation of real-time dashboards and analytics views, enabling data-driven monitoring and insights.
  • Automate regular maintenance tasks such as backups, archiving, and cleanup using scripts and AWS utilities.
  • Participate in performance testing, audit reviews, and system hardening exercises.
  • Maintain database documentation, including data models, schema diagrams, and migration logs.

Required Skills & Experience:

  • 3–5 years of hands-on experience as a Database Administrator or SQL Developer in large-scale environments.
  • Strong command of MySQL, including schema design, indexing, partitioning, and replication.
  • Experience with AWS DynamoDB, including data modeling, query optimization, and integration with AWS services.
  • Expertise in query optimization, database performance tuning, and resource utilization analysis.
  • Proficiency in SQL scripting, ETL workflows, and data migration planning.
  • Familiarity with AWS cloud services (RDS, S3, Lambda, Glue, CloudWatch) and DevOps practices for database deployment.
  • Working knowledge of data visualization and dashboarding tools (e.g., Power BI, Metabase, or similar) for operational

    analytics.
  • Strong understanding of data security, encryption, and backup strategies.
  • Excellent analytical, troubleshooting, and documentation skills.


  • Pune, Maharashtra, India Cummins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    DescriptionJob Summary:Responsible for the installation, creation, monitoring, support, maintenance and optimization of databases; participates in design; ensures secure database access, data integrity and security, as well as manages performance and capacity.Key Responsibilities:Analyzes data on existing databases and makes process improvement and...


  • Pune, Maharashtra, India Tata Consultancy Servicess Full time

    Company DescriptionWe suggest you enter details here.Role DescriptionThis is a full-time on-site role for an Oracle Database Administrator, located in Pune. The Oracle Database Administrator will be responsible for managing and maintaining Oracle databases. The day-to-day tasks include database administration, replication, troubleshooting any issues that...


  • Pune, Maharashtra, India Equifax Full time

    What you'll doKnowledge of large-scale enterprise data solutions with a focus on high availability, low latency and scalability.Aid in creating documentation and have an understanding of Disaster Recovery as part of application deployment.Test infrastructure as code (IAC) patterns that meet security and engineering standards using one or more technologies...


  • Pune, Maharashtra, India Cummins Full time ₹ 40,00,000 - ₹ 80,00,000 per year

    DescriptionJob Summary:Responsible for the installation, creation, monitoring, support, maintenance and optimization of databases; participates in design; ensures secure database access, data integrity and security, as well as manages performance and capacity.Key Responsibilities:Monitors existing databases and equipment to ensure expected results are...


  • Pune, Maharashtra, India Michelin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    Database Administrator-DAP As a DBA you manage and administer the company's data management systems, ensuring consistency, quality and security according to the Michelin group's prescriptions. You participate in the implementation of the databases and automated services provided to our partners and you provide high-performance databases that meet the...


  • Pune, Maharashtra, India Shashwath Solution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    ACL Digital is seeking experienced Database Administrators (DBAs) to perform Oracle DB maintenance activities and support existing Oracle E-Business Suite (EBS) application databases. Responsibilities include managing and expediting the instance cloning process using tools like Actifio, supporting legacy reporting environments, and ensuring the proper...


  • Pune, Maharashtra, India YASH Technologies Full time

    Company DescriptionYASH Technologies is a consulting-led transformation partner with a proven track record of helping customers address their digital transformation challenges. Recognized as "Large enough to transform and small enough to care," we have earned the trust of 75+ global F500 companies as their "Digital Partner of choice." We combine robust...


  • Pune, Maharashtra, India Cummins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    DescriptionJob Summary:Responsible for the installation, creation, monitoring, support, maintenance and optimization of databases; participates in design; ensures secure database access, data integrity and security, as well as manages performance and capacity.Key Responsibilities:Directs the most complex database designs; directs and reviews all phases of...


  • Pune, Maharashtra, India Prodege, LLC Full time ₹ 12,00,000 - ₹ 36,00,000 per year

    OverviewThe MySQL Database Administrator plays a critical role in maintaining the reliability, performance, and scalability of our database systems. By combining advanced MySQL expertise with strong Linux administration skills, this role ensures our data platforms support high-volume, mission-critical applications. The successful candidate will drive...


  • Pune, Maharashtra, India TransPerfect Full time ₹ 12,00,000 - ₹ 24,00,000 per year

    OVERVIEWThe TransPerfect TechOps team has been a vital part of the company's success since its formation 10 years ago – delivering technology and services that have drastically simplified the lives of our clients and colleagues – from workflow improvements for colleagues, to core services that form the basis...